diff --git a/.github/workflows/codespell.yml b/.github/workflows/codespell.yml
new file mode 100644
index 000000000..8d6ddc2b9
--- /dev/null
+++ b/.github/workflows/codespell.yml
@@ -0,0 +1,23 @@
+# Codespell configuration is within .codespellrc
+---
+name: Codespell
+
+on:
+ push:
+ branches: [main]
+ pull_request:
+ branches: [main]
+
+permissions:
+ contents: read
+
+jobs:
+ codespell:
+ name: Check for spelling errors
+ runs-on: ubuntu-latest
+
+ steps:
+ - name: Checkout
+ uses: actions/checkout@v6
+ - name: Codespell
+ uses: codespell-project/actions-codespell@8f01853be192eb0f849a5c7d721450e7a467c579 # v2.2
